Restorative Dental Services
When cavities or tooth damage occur, restorative dentistry plays a key role in bringing smiles back to full function and health. Common restorative procedures include:
- Fillings: Used to repair cavities and restore tooth structure, fillings in Springfield are often performed using composite resin (tooth-colored) or amalgam (silver) materials. The choice of material depends on the location and extent of the decay, as well as patient preference. The process typically involves cleaning out the decayed portion of the tooth and then filling the space.
- Crowns: For more significantly damaged teeth, a crown (or cap) may be recommended. This is a custom-made covering that fits over the entire tooth, restoring its shape, size, strength, and appearance. Various materials like porcelain, ceramic, or metal alloys are used to create crowns, with many Springfield dentists prioritizing aesthetically pleasing porcelain options.
- Bridges: These are fixed prosthetic devices used to replace one or more missing teeth. A bridge typically looks like a set of artificial teeth and is anchored to natural teeth or implants on either side of the gap.
- Root Canals For teeth with severely infected or damaged pulp, a root canal procedure can save the tooth from extraction. This involves removing the infected pulp, cleaning and disinfecting the inside of the tooth, and then filling and sealing it. While often associated with discomfort, modern root canal treatments performed by Springfield dental professionals are highly effective and far more comfortable than in the past.
Preventive Treatments for Enhanced Oral Health
Beyond routine care, family dentists in Springfield offer several preventive measures to bolster your family’s oral hygiene.
- Dental Sealants: These are thin plastic coatings applied to the chewing surfaces of back teeth (molars and premolars). They form a protective barrier over the enamel, preventing food particles and bacteria from settling into the grooves of the teeth and causing decay. Sealants are particularly beneficial for children and teenagers.
- Fluoride Treatments: Fluoride is a natural mineral that strengthens tooth enamel and makes teeth more resistant to acid attacks from plaque bacteria and sugars. Professional fluoride applications, often in the form of a gel, foam, or varnish, are a simple yet effective way to enhance cavity prevention, especially for those prone to decay.

How often should my child see a family dentist?
The American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ry recommends that a child’s first dental visit should occur by their first birthday or within six months of their first tooth erupting. After this initial visit, it is generally recommended that children see a family dentist for regular check-ups every six months. This consistent schedule helps in monitoring their dental development, preventing early childhood cavities, and establishing good oral hygiene habits from a young age. It also helps build a foundation of comfort and trust with the dental team as they grow.
